Security Patent in $2 Billion Cisco Suit to Undergo Board Review

A network security patent underlying a $1.9 billion judgment against Cisco Systems Inc. will be reviewed by a patent office tribunal, based on a challenge brought by cybersecurity company Palo Alto Networks Inc.

Cisco was found in October 2020 to infringe four Centripetal Networks Inc. patents following a bench trial in the Eastern District of Virginia. Cisco, which is appealing the ruling, says it would owe over $2.75 billion with royalties.
